    General properties of the phase shiftsExpansion useful at low energies: small number of valuesThe phase shift (and all derivatives) are continuous functions of EThe phase shift is known within np: exp(2id)=exp(2i(d+np))Levinson theorem d(E=0) - d(E=)= Np , where N is the number of bound states Example: p+n, =0: d(E=0) - d(E=)= p (bound deuteron)

  • Interpretation of the phase shift from the wave functiondl0 V attractiveu(r)rV=0 u(r)sin(kr-lp/2) dl=0V0 u(r)sin(kr-lp/2+dl)

  • Resonances:=Breit-Wigner approximationER=resonance energy G=resonance width Narrow resonance: G small Broad resonance: G largeExample: 12C+pWith resonance: ER=0.42 MeV, G=32 keV lifetime: t=}/G~2x10-20 sWithout resonance: interaction range d~10 fm interaction time t=d/v ~1.1x10-21 s
